Update: 1 of 6 runaways sought by Big Island police located; have you seen any of the others?

One of the 6, Aulani Alfapada, was located Aug. 22 in good health. Anyone who might have information about the whereabouts of any of the other missing teens is asked to call the Hawai‘i Police Department’s non-emergency line at 808-935-3311 or contact Officer Corey Kaneko.

Have you seen either of these 17-year-olds? Big Island police want to know

17-year-old Deacon Hawk was last seen Aug. 3 in Hilo and 17-year-old Cherish Ahulau-Kaleo was last seen July 20 in Hilo. Both were reported as runaways.
